Big-hearted customers have been praised for helping raise over £500 in a single day.

Merton MIND, a mental health charity, held a tin collection outside Sainsbury’s, in Colliers Wood, which raised £533.51 to help with new projects this summer.

Susan Bowman, the group’s chairman, said: “We are grateful for people being so generous and to Sainsbury’s for letting us on their site.

"This will help some of the services we provide for people with mental health problems in Merton.”
